Robbie Savage says that Tottenham Hotspur need to sign a player with the ‘wow factor’.

The former Wales international has also underlined the importance of keeping hold of star striker Harry Kane and superb midfielder Dele Alli.

“Where the Gunners sold Robin van Persie and Cesc Fabregas, Tottenham must keep hold of Harry Kane and Dele Alli,” Savage wrote in The Mirror.
“And sooner or later, Pochettino needs to sign a player with the ‘wow’ factor – and raise the ceiling of Spurs’ wage structure – to prove they can compete with the Manchester clubs, Liverpool and Chelsea for the biggest stars.
“Whether that means bringing Gareth Bale back from Real Madrid, or landing a marquee signing along the lines of Didier Drogba joining Chelsea in 2004, that shiny new stadium will need trophies in the cabinet and elite players on the pitch.”

Tottenham have a very good squad that are competing for the Premier League title and have also progressed to the last-16 stage of the Champions League this season.
A big-name player will certainly enhance the quality of the current Spurs team, but do the North London outfit actually need such a player?
After all, things are going well for Tottenham at the moment, and there is no need for manager Mauricio Pochettino to bring in a big-name player just for the sake of it.
As far as re-signing Gareth Bale from Real Madrid is concerned, there is no point in that as the Wales international winger has not progressed much since leaving Spurs in 2013.
